Highlights
- Zion spends 111.7% more per student than Schertz.
- The Student Teacher Ratio is 11.5% lower in Zion than in Schertz. (lower means fewer students in each classroom).
- Zion had 12.7% fewer residents who had graduated High School compared to Schertz
